The formula

FormulaTrip cost = distance × consumption/100 × fuel price; weekly cost = trip cost × trips per week; cost per rider = weekly cost / riders

The inputs explained

FieldWhat to enter
Round-trip distance (km)A number, measured in km. Starts at 40.
Fuel consumption (L/100km)A number, measured in L/100km. Starts at 8.
Fuel price ($/L)A number, measured in your currency/L. Starts at 1.9.
Trips per weekA number. Starts at 5.
Riders sharing the cost (including driver)A number. Starts at 4.
